Scrying for Divination

What Is Scrying Scrying is the practice of psychically “seeing” things in a medium usually for the purpose of having spiritual visions. Some of the mediums that can be used are water, fire, smoke, glass, mirrors, crystals as well as other reflective, translucent and luminescent surfaces. Healing Herb List #5

Coughroot (Trillium Erectum); also called birthroot, Indian shamrock, lamb’s quarters, Beth root, wake-Robin, Indian balm, ground lily, Jew’s – harp plant, milk ipecac, Pariswort, rattlesnake root, snakebite or nightshade.
